UCO Bank Apprentice Recruitment 2025 Begins For 532 Apprentice Posts; Check Details
United Commercial Bank or UCO Bank has announced a recruitment drive for 532 apprentice positions. Those who have completed graduation in any discipline may apply by visiting the UCO Bank website, uco.bank.in, and complete the online application form by October 30, 2025.
The selection process will involve an online examination with 100 questions. Successful candidates will receive training at UCO Bank and a stipend. This opportunity is ideal for graduates aiming for a banking career.
UCO Bank has announced 532 vacancies across the country, including 86 in Uttar Pradesh, 46 in West Bengal, 42 in New Delhi, 37 in Pondicherry, 35 in Bihar, 33 in Maharashtra, 27 in Madhya Pradesh, 21 in Rajasthan, 19 in Gujarat, 14 in Haryana, 24 each in Assam and Odisha, 12 each in Karnataka and Jharkhand, 10 each in Telangana, Chhattisgarh and Kerala, and 1 to 8 seats in states like Goa, Sikkim, Manipur.
UCO Bank Apprentice Recruitment 2025: Who Can Apply?
Candidates must have a graduate degree in any discipline from a recognised university. Degrees such as BA, B.Sc, B.Com, or B.Tech are all acceptable. Both freshers and experienced individuals are eligible to apply.
Applicants must be aged between 20 and 28 years as of October 30, 2025. Age relaxation is provided for SC/ST, OBC, and PwD candidates as per the rules.
UCO Bank Apprentices Jobs: Selection Process
Selection is based on a written examination. The 60-minute online exam consists of 100 multiple-choice questions. Each question carries one mark, with 25 questions on General/Financial Awareness, 25 on General English, 25 on Reasoning Ability and Computer Aptitude, and 25 on Quantitative Aptitude. There is no negative marking, so answer without worry. Those who pass will proceed to document verification and training as per the merit list.
UCO Bank Apprentices Jobs: Application Fee
General, OBC, and EWS candidates will be charged a fee of Rs 800, while PwD candidates will need to pay Rs 400 plus GST. SC/ST candidates are exempt from paying any fee.
UCO Bank Apprentices Recruitment 2025: Required Documents
Prepare these documents for the interview or verification:
— Graduation marksheet and degree
— Aadhar card, PAN card
— Passport size photo (2-3 copies)
— Date of birth proof (10th certificate)
— Category certificate if SC/ST/OBC/PwD
UCO Bank Apprentice Recruitment 2025: How To Apply?
Step 1- Visit the UCO Bank website, uco.bank.in.
Step 2- Locate the Apprentice Recruitment 2025 notification in the Careers or Recruitment section.
Step 3- Click on the online form link. Enter accurate details such as name, degree, and age.
Step 4- Upload your photo, signature, and required documents.

Step 5- Pay the fees and submit the form.
Step 6- Print out the form for verification purposes.
